Mechanism of Improved Aortic Orifice Area Postmortem and intraoperative dilatations have demonstrated how balloon aortic valvuloplasty improves the adult aortic valve with calcific degenerative aortic stenosis. The mechanism of dilatation appears pre dominantly to be fracturing of the calcific aortic valve nod ules. The likely mechanism of restenosis is fusion of the cracks or crevices in calcific nodules on the aortic leaflets. The balloon dilatation process not often dislodges the amorphous calcific deposits, and embolization is uncommon. The fractured calcific nodules may heal with fibrosis, which might be the most typical prevalence, and in some cases even with ossification and true bone formation. This finish plate potential normally causes enough depolarization to open neighboring voltage-gated sodium channels, allowing even greater sodium ion inflow and initiating an motion potential that the synaptic area, continues to activate acetylcholine receptors as long as the acetylcholine persists in the space. A small quantity of acetylcholine diffuses out of the synaptic area and is then now not out there to act on the muscle fiber membrane. The quick time that the acetylcholine remains in the synaptic space-a few milliseconds at most-normally is sufficient to excite the muscle fiber. Then the fast removing of the acetylcholine prevents continued muscle re-excitation after the muscle fiber has recovered from its preliminary motion potential. The sudden insurgence of sodium ions into the muscle fiber when the acetylcholine-gated channels open causes the electrical potential contained in the fiber at the native space of the top plate to increase in the optimistic path as a lot as 50 to 75 millivolts, creating a local potential referred to as the end plate potential. Recall from Chapter 5 that a sudden improve in nerve membrane potential of more than 20 to 30 millivolts is generally adequate to initiate increasingly sodium channel opening, thus initiating an action potential on the muscle fiber membrane. End plate potentials A and C are too weak to elicit an motion potential, however they do produce weak native end plate voltage changes, as recorded within the determine. The weak spot of the end plate potential at level A was caused by poisoning of the muscle fiber with curare, a drug that blocks the gating action of acetylcholine on the acetylcholine channels by competing for the acetylcholine receptor sites. The weakness of the top plate potential at point C resulted from the impact of botulinum toxin, a bacterial poison that decreases the quantity of acetylcholine launch by the nerve terminals. Safety Factor for Transmission at the Neuromuscular Junction-Fatigue of the Junction. Ordinarily, every impulse that arrives at the neuromuscular junction causes about thrice as much end plate potential as that required to stimulate the muscle fiber. Therefore, the normal neuromuscular junction is alleged to have a excessive safety issue. However, stimulation of the nerve fiber at rates higher than a hundred occasions per second for several minutes could diminish the variety of acetylcholine vesicles a lot that impulses fail to cross into the muscle fiber. Under normal functioning circumstances, measurable fatigue of the neuromuscular junction occurs not often and, even then, only at the most exhausting ranges of muscle exercise.

Although each muscle fiber is innervated by a single motor neuron, an entire muscle may obtain input from tons of of various motor neurons. Slow fibers have a more extensive blood vessel system and extra capillaries to provide additional quantities of oxygen in contrast with fast fibers, 4. Slow fibers have greatly increased numbers of mitochondria to assist high levels of oxidative metabolism. Slow fibers contain giant quantities of myoglobin, an iron-containing protein similar to hemoglobin in pink blood cells. Myoglobin combines with oxygen and stores it until wanted, which additionally tremendously speeds oxygen transport to the mitochondria. The myoglobin gives the gradual muscle a reddish appearance- hence, the name red muscle. Fast fibers have an in depth sarcoplasmic reticulum for speedy release of calcium ions to provoke contraction. Large amounts of glycolytic enzymes are current in quick fibers for rapid release of vitality by the glycolytic process. Fast fibers have a much less in depth blood supply than sluggish fibers because oxidative metabolism is of secondary importance. Fast fibers have fewer mitochondria than sluggish fibers, additionally as a outcome of oxidative metabolism is secondary. In common, small muscle tissue that react quickly and whose control should be exact have more nerve fibers for fewer muscle fibers. An average determine for all of the muscle tissue of the physique is questionable, however a reasonable guess would be about 80 to a hundred muscle fibers to a motor unit.
